Recently, Dongting Lake in central China's Hunan Province has entered the peak period of winter bird migration. The latest data shows that the current number of wintering birds in the eastern Dongting Lake has reached 100,000, with a total of 41 species recorded.

Thousands of wild ducks congregate in the waters of Caisang Lake within the eastern Dongting Lake, leisurely basking in the sun every day. Xiong Gaofeng, a longtime patrol officer stationed at Caisang Lake, has observed 19 species of wild ducks, with the falcated ducks being the main force in this area.

Xiong said: "Now you can see birds here every day, and the water quality of Caisang Lake is getting better, attracting more and more birds. We have already entered the peak period of bird migration, and when the temperature drops further, more migratory birds will arrive."

In the waters of the eastern Dongting Lake, just a dyke away from Caisang Lake, various kinds of migratory birds are gathered in groups, gather in their own territories, undisturbed, to find their favorite foods. This year, the Junshan District of Yueyang City, integrated nearly 20,000 hectares of water in the Caisang Lake area of East Dongting Lake, revitalizing water resources, and establishing an intelligent fishery supervision system. Through measures such as meteorology, underwater sensing, and fish passage construction, staff of the district are monitoring real-time water dissolved oxygen levels, distribution of aquatic organisms, and establishing an underwater ecosystem, providing a natural feeding ground for wintering migratory birds.

An employee of the Junshan Ecological Fisheries Group in Hunan said they use the quantity of plankton to assess whether there is enough fish food in the water, which in turn estimates the size of the fish. This is important as fish are part of the diet for some migratory birds. Adequate food supply results in a large influx of birds, which is beneficial for their breeding and migration.

This year, Yueyang City also took a series of measures including building water conservation facilities and restoring submerged vegetation in the Dongting Lake basin, improving the overall water retention capacity and expanding wintering bird habitats. According to the latest data, it is anticipated that the population of wintering birds in the eastern Dongting Lake will peak at the end of December, with the overall number exceeding 300,000.
